Cameo Cake
By: AnonymousPosted by Anonymous
Wonderful White Chocolate Cake!Cameo Cake
Ingredients
- 1 1/2 cups butter 3/4 cup water 3/4 cup white chocolate chips 1 1/2 cups buttermilk 4 egg, beaten 1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ract 3 1/2 cups all-purpose flour 1 cup chopped toasted pecans 2 1/4 cups white sugar 1 1/2 teaspoons baking soda 4 (1 ounce) squares white chocolate, melted 1 (8 ounce) package cream cheese, softened 1 (3 ounce) package cream cheese, softened 1/3 cup butter, softened 6 1/2 cups confectioners' sugar 1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ract
Instructions
1 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ease and flour three 8 or 9 inch round cake pans. Stir together 3 cups flour, white sugar, and soda. Set aside.
2 Combine 1 1/2 cup butter and water in a medium saucepan. Bring to a boil over medium heat, stirring occasionally. Remove from heat, and add 4 ounces white chocolate. Stir until chocolate melts. Stir in buttermilk, eggs, and 1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la. Gradually stir in flour mixture; batter will be thin. Dredge pecans in 1/2 cup flour, and fold into batter. Pour into prepared pans.
3 Bake for 20 to 25 minute. Cool layers in pans for 10 minutes. Remove from pans, and cool completely on wire racks.
4 To make the frosting: Beat together both packages of cream cheese and 1/3 cup butter until creamy. Blend in melted and cooled white chocolate. Mix in confectioner's sugar and 1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la. Frost between layers, and on top and sides of cake. Sprinkle with additional pecans if desired.
